Why does this song work so well in movies and TV? It’s all about emotional resonance. When directors and music supervisors pick a song for a scene, they're not just filling silence. They're trying to tap into what the audience is feeling, or what they want the audience to feel. And "Listen to the Music" is a masterclass in triggering positive vibes. It’s like that trusty old friend who always knows how to lighten the mood, whether you’re celebrating a win or just trying to get through a tough Tuesday.

Imagine you’re watching a scene where a group of characters finally comes together, overcoming their differences. What’s playing? If it’s "Listen to the Music," you instantly understand. It’s a signal: "Okay, things are getting good. We're all in this together now." It’s the sonic equivalent of a collective sigh of relief and a shared smile.

When Life Gives You a Montage…

One of the most common places you’ll hear this gem is during a montage. You know, those quick-cut sequences that show characters working towards a goal, building something, or just generally having a fantastic time? Think about a character who’s been struggling, and then suddenly, they’re whipping into shape, making progress, and feeling that newfound confidence. "Listen to the Music" is the perfect backdrop for that transformation. It’s like the camera is saying, "Look at them go! They're feeling it, and you should too!"
